Shildon Town Council is launching their first ‘Blooming Best Garden Competition’, and we would like all you green fingered residents, young and old, to all to get involved.
How to enter, simply complete the form below and upload a picture of your garden taken this year. There are 8 categories to enter under, from Best Front Garden, Community and Multi-User Gardens, Allotments or Edible Gardens to Building a Bug Hotel, so come on Shildon, show us how your garden grows.
“Councillors have been noticing the hard work that people put into gardens and yards around the town, and really appreciate the cumulative effect this creates in making Shildon a brighter and more beautiful place to live and work. We thought it something worth celebrating this summer, so have joined forces with GARDENA, a trusted gardening brand employing local people at their Newton Aycliffe site, to create this Shildon’s Blooming Best Gardens Competition, and we would love as many people as possible to join in the celebration.”
A spokesperson for the well-known garden brand told us a little about why they were delighted to give their support. “GARDENA, part of the Husqvarna Group, is excited to be supporting this local initiative with the Shildon Town Council. As more people are turning to their gardens and green spaces for relaxation and wellness, we as a brand want to support all passionate gardeners out there, in creating beautiful spaces that can be enjoyed by the whole community.”
The deadline to receive garden entries is 5.00pm 1st September 2021, to ensure we see your garden, allotment, or green space at its best. All entrants will receive a Certificate of Merit and category winners will receive a Certificate of Excellence along with a prize, so dig out your wellies and let’s get gardening.

Prizes for the Shildon Best Blooming Garden Competition have been announced. There are prizes across the eight competition categories as follows.
- Category 1. Best Front Garden – £50 prize money plus a GARDENA CleverRoll hose trolley set with 25m hose and comfort multisprayer gun and hamper of garden care products.
- Category 2. Best Back Garden – £50 prize money plus a GARDENA CleverRoll hose trolley set with 25m hose and comfort multisprayer gun and a hamper of garden care products.
- Category 3. Best Frontage Shop – £50 prize money plus a GARDENA Balcony Box set, planting mat and gloves set.
- Category 4. Home Frontage – for properties that open onto the street – £50 prize money plus a GARDENA Balcony box, planting mat and gloves set.
- Category 5. Hidden Garden – a space or location not visible from the street – £50 prize money plus a GARDENA Liano Textile 20m hose and Comfort Multispray gun.
- Category 6. Allotment or Edible Garden – £50 prize money plus a GARDENA Liano Textile 20m hose and Comfort Multispray gun.
- Category 7. Community / Multi User Garden – i.e. shared or residential accommodation or community project – £50 prize money plus a GARDENA CleverRoll hose trolley set with 25m hose and comfort multisprayer gun and a hamper of garden products.
- Category 8. Best Bug Hotel – the category for the younger gardeners – a Family Pass for Planet Leisure at Newton Aycliffe plus a GARDENA ClickUp Bird feeder.
The competition organisers are also offering an extra prize, to be awarded to the entry the judges agree to be best from the winners across all eight categories, which is dinner for two persons at Shildon’s Civic Hall.
